2 DEFINED TERMS
"Competition" means the David-Carter.com reverse auction themed prize competition.. "Bid" means the attempt to obtain a specified Prize by way of putting forward a stipulated hypothetical price, as communicated to Us online. The aim of the Player is to put forward the Unique Lowest Bid. "Player"/"You" means the individual who participates in the Competition by placing a Bid. "Prize" means any domain name from time to time stipulated by Us, to be offered as a Prize by Us (and reference in these terms and conditions to "the Prize" will include, unless the context otherwise requires, references to individual items comprised in a group of two or more items offered as one Prize). "Lowest Unique Bid" means the lowest whole number Bid for a Prize that is closest to one (1), that has not been selected by any other Player. Zero or negative amounts are not allowed. "Online Player" means an individual who participates in the Competition by placing Bids through the Website. "Our", "We" or "Us" means Hollywood Internet Ltd, a company registered in England and Wales (Company Number 04661510). Our address for correspondence is Hollywood Internet Ltd., 23 Lea Green Lane, Birmingham, B47 6HE, United Kingdom"Winner" means the Player who has the Unique Lowest Bid at the close of the Competition. "Website" means Our website with the URL "david-carter.com"

4 OFFER
4.1 We may, from time to time, as stipulated offer a Prize to be won by way of a reverse auction themed prize competition (the "Offer") subject to the following conditions:
(a) the Prize shall be awarded to the Player who bids the Unique Lowest Bid and
(b) each Offer shall remain open for such period as We shall stipulate (the "Bidding Period") but may be revoked at any time by notice from Us.
4.2 We will accept only a limited number of Bids per Competition.
4.3 Unless otherwise stated within the Prize description, no Prize shall include reimbursement of any travel and other expenses incurred by the Winner in connection with the receipt of the Prize.
4.4 The Prize does not include costs of transfer of Domain Names that might be applied by certain registrars, such as Nominet. These costs will be met by the User.
5 ACCEPTANCE
5.1 Bids may only be made in pence and cost 1 credit per Bid. The price of credits in each auction may vary. We accept Mastercard, Visa, Switch, Delta, and Maestro cards for bids made online within the UK. Outside the UK for bids made online we accept payment by Mastercard, Maestro, Delta and Visa cards. Online bids cost 1 credit per bid and can only be purchased individually at £1 each, then in blocks of 15 (£10.00), 40 (£25.00), and 100 (£50.00).
5.2 An Offer by Us shall be deemed accepted on receipt by Us of the online Bid from the Player outlining his or her Unique Lowest Bid. Online Bids from Players must be received by Us during the Bidding Period in order to be entered into the Competition. Any online Bids received by Us after the Bidding Period, may be entered into a subsequent Competition, at Our discretion.
5.3 The Unique Lowest Bid shall be determined by Us in our absolute discretion after the expiry of the Bidding Period.
5.4 Confirmation of the identity of the Player with the Unique Lowest Bid shall be communicated to the individual Player by Us, by whatever means it deems appropriate.
5.5 On the acceptance of the Offer by the Player who sends online to Us what is determined to be the Unique Lowest Bid at the close of the Bidding Period ("the Winner"), a binding legal contract is made for the award of the Prize by Us and the Winner assumes full responsibility for the Prize.
5.6 In the event that we deem in our discretion the Winner to have secured the Lowest Unique Bid by way of machine, by way of multiple Accounts registered to email accounts owned by the Winner, by way of multiple email addresses owned by the same Player, or by way of participation in conjunction with a syndicate or group bidding process which is unfair to the Competition, the Winner's Bids will be declared void. Such Bids are non-refundable by Us.
